    Dodged a very pricey bullet here. My experience with the receptionist and the other person who…read morelooked up insurance was excellent, but I couldn't believe all of the additional charges I would have to pay vs my old eye Dr. I only called here because my insurance changed and they were on the list. I would literally pay 200 less for my simple needs if I just went to my old Dr. and even payed out of pocket, skipping my insurance entirely. It was disconcerting to hear so many warnings, disclaimers and "fine print" from an eye Dr. I just wanted a simple frame and contact prescription renewed and have no eye problems. They wanted my medical insurance info up front in case they found a problem and warned there would be additional charges they would have to bill my medical insurance for if they found anything. That made me feel uneasy. Never had to do that before, and what did that mean exactly? In addition, seems like they have a state of the art retinal scanner that I'd have to pay out of pocket for that was another 40.00 or so. It's not necessary to get because dilation is covered by insurance on most exams. Dilation is still gold standard for eye exams. It allows the doctor to see the far edges of your retina in 3 d vs 2 d. This is allows for spotting issues like retinal tears, tumors, or early signs of diabetes and high blood pressure. Anyhow, they also have their own tier system on how they book you, and they charge you a 150 to 250+ for a simple contact lens scrip and fitting, and mentioned other possible fees. The straw for me was the automatic 42.00 "booking fee" on top of a copay, 160 for contacts exam, another 49 for scan, possible other charges before even getting glasses/contacts I'm sorry, what? Obviously their priority is profit..and while that may be normal as a business, this is excessive and insulting. While doctors cannot legally manufacture a fake diagnosis (as falsifying records to bill insurance is a severe criminal offense), aggressive practices can exploit gray areas by up-billing for minor, harmless findings like standard eye strain or slight dryness, itchyness from environmental allergy, etc. I'm not saying the care is bad, I'm sure they are highly qualified but you had better get a quote in writing before receiving care to avoid surprises. Check your insurance carefully. I'd estimate an out of pocket cost for the appointment, glasses and contacts.. assuming they will let you choose pretty basic would be 650 to 1000 when all is said and done. I did some research and found that vision insurance companies have drastically cut payouts. Routine vision plans (like VSP or EyeMed) often pay doctors incredibly low rates for an exam. Conversely, medical insurance payouts have generally kept closer pace with inflation. I don't know if that's what's happening overall, but it's concerning that it's just something else to be aware of in the healthcare battles we increasingly face.
